Montenegro utility to build its first battery storage systems

In a pioneering move for state-owned utilities in the Balkans, Montenegro''s Elektroprivreda Crne Gore (EPCG) is looking to deliver 185 MWh of battery energy storage capacity across four locations.

Largest battery energy storage project in Sweden planned for H1

Recently-formed energy storage developer Ingrid Capacity is building a 70MW battery storage facility in Sweden for a delivery date as early as H1 2024, the largest planned in the Nordic country. UK Capacity Market contracts handed to 627MW of battery storage

Battery storage projects totalling 627MW were awarded contracts in the UK''s 2023-24 Capacity Market auction which concluded yesterday (14 February), nearly a two-thirds jump on last year''s. Montenegrin EPCG plans 245 MWh of BESS at its own facilities

The Montenegrin state-owned utility EPCG has adopted plans for battery storage systems (BESS) with up to 245 MWh of combined capacity at its existing facilities, to boost its power system flexibility, it said on Tuesday.

EPCG Launches Montenegro''s Largest Battery Storage Project. Elektroprivreda Crne Gore (EPCG), Montenegro''s leading electricity company, has begun preparations on the installation of 245 MWh of battery energy storage systems (BESS). This step marks an important milestone in the region''s energy evolution.
